R Igraph Tutorial

Lets load in the Karate network from Network Example Data. Igraph is a package that provides tools for the analysis and visualization of networks.


Top 20 R Machine Learning And Data Science Packages Machine Learning Data Science Machine Learning Book

The igraph library provides versatile options for descriptive network analysis and visualization in R Python and CC.

R igraph tutorial. Download the R script for this tutorial here. Ognyanova primarily uses igraph but she also introduces interactive networks. A collection of vertices or nodes and undirected edges or ties denoted 𝒢V E where V is a the vertex set and E is the edge set.

Precompiled Windows wheels for igraphs Python interface are available on the Python Package Index see Installing igraph from the Python Package Index. My long-term plans are to extend this tutorial into a proper manual-style documentation to igraph in the next chapters. Query or set attributes of the edges in an edge sequence.

R news and tutorials contributed by hundreds of R bloggers. Posted on February 5 2017 by Data Imaginist - R posts in R bloggers 0 Comments This article was first published on Data Imaginist - R posts and kindly contributed. The simplest way to install the igraph R package is typing installpackages igraph in your R session.

Chapter 1 Igraph 11Aboutigraph For the purposes of this book igraph is an extension package for R. Igraph is a collection of network analysis tools with the emphasis on efficiency portability and ease of use. 22 Create networks and basics concepts.

Igraph can be programmed in R Python Mathematica and CC. With a great igraph tutorial here. This video shows how to create such an igraph object from raw data.

Performing network analysis in R is easy - thanks to wonderful packages such as igraph. Igraph implements all of the commonly used centrality indices. How do you actually do this.

This post presents an example of social network analysis with R using package igraph. Select edges and show their metadata. Ad Take your skills to a new level and join millions of users that have learned R.

Getting and setting graph attributes shortcut. In the meanwhile check out the full API documentation which should provide information about almost every igraph class function or method. However the standard indices are usually more than enough.

With R and igraph Gabor Csardi csardirmkikfkihu Department of Biophysics KFKI Research Institute for Nuclear and Particle Physics of the Hungarian Academy of Sciences Budapest Hungary Currently at Department of Medical Genetics University of Lausanne Lausanne Switzerland. In the meanwhile check out the full API documentation which should provide information about. Ad Take your skills to a new level and join millions of users that have learned R.

What is a network or graph. This tutorial covers basics of network analysis and visualization with the R package igraph maintained by Gabor Csardi and Tamas Nepusz. Practical statistical network analysis WU Wien 2.

How igraph functions handle attributes when the graph changes. Back to main page. My long-term plans are to extend this tutorial into a proper manual-style documentation to igraph in the next chapters.

The data to analyze is Twitter text data of RDataMining used in the example of Text Mining and it can be downloaded as file termDocMatrixrdata at the Data webpagePutting it in a general scenario of social networks the terms can be taken as people and the tweets as groups on LinkedIn and. Basic Network Analysis in R Basic Network Analysis in R Centrality If you want more indices check out the centiserve and CINNA package. Its in GML format so well need to specify that when we use read_graph.

This presents both a helpful introduction to the visual aspects of networks and a more in depth tutorial on creating network plots in R. There are two relatively recent books published on network analysis with R by Springer. In this post I showed a visualization of the organizational network of my department.

CRAN release page for igraph Development version. 3 days ago This tutorial was only scratching the surface of what igraph can do. Although I have used it sparingly the R package brainGraph has some useful functions that lend themselves to brain graph analysis in particular.

Delete vertices or edges from a graph. Since several people asked for details how the plot has been produced I will provide the code and some extensions below. Loading in Data into igraph The igraph package has parsers for reading in most of the general file formats for networks.

But its mostly built on igraph which I prefer I will skirt around a number of theoretical and methodological considerations and will focus on practicality. This workshop will focus on the R implementation. Library igraph Graphs Some Definitions.

Degree degree weighted degree graphstrength betweenness betweenness. The plot has been done entirely in R 21401 with the help of the igraph package. This github page provide a basic introduction on network analysis using R.

Igraph tutorial in R. Libraryigraph karate. Graph plotting in igraph is implemented using a third-party package called CairoIf you want to create publication-quality plots in igraph on Windows you must also install Cairo and its Python.

211 igraph vs statnet. It is a collectionorRfunctionstoexplorecreate. Learn key takeaway skills of R and earn a certificate of completion.

Submit a new job its free Browse latest jobs also free Contact us. Learn key takeaway skills of R and earn a certificate of completion. This tutorial was only scratching the surface of what igraph can do.

It is a great package but I found the documentation somewhat difficult to use so. The documents are based on the lab materials of STAT650 Social Network at Duke University. If you want to download the package manually the following link leads you to the page of the latest release on CRAN where you can pick the appropriate source or binary distribution yourself.

Igraph is open source and free. Igraph R package python-igraph IGraphM igraph C library.


Contracting And Simplifying A Network Graph Graphing Data Visualization Simplify


This Tutorial Explains About Random Forest In Simple Term And How It Works With Examples It Includes Step By Step Gu Data Science Deep Learning Data Analytics


An Example Of Social Network Analysis With R Using Package Igraph R Bloggers Data Science Analysis Data Scientist


LihatTutupKomentar